About

Gunasekaran Kumar is a scholar working on Fluid Flow and Transfer Processes, Biomedical Engineering and Surgery. According to data from OpenAlex, Gunasekaran Kumar has authored 80 papers receiving a total of 1.4k indexed citations (citations by other indexed papers that have themselves been cited), including 40 papers in Fluid Flow and Transfer Processes, 35 papers in Biomedical Engineering and 26 papers in Surgery. Recurrent topics in Gunasekaran Kumar's work include Advanced Combustion Engine Technologies (40 papers), Biodiesel Production and Applications (34 papers) and Vehicle emissions and performance (18 papers). Gunasekaran Kumar is often cited by papers focused on Advanced Combustion Engine Technologies (40 papers), Biodiesel Production and Applications (34 papers) and Vehicle emissions and performance (18 papers). Gunasekaran Kumar collaborates with scholars based in India, United Kingdom and Malaysia. Gunasekaran Kumar's co-authors include Jayashish Kumar Pandey, B. S. N. Prasad, K. V. Shivaprasad, Ajay Kumar Yadav, Praveen Mereddy, S. R. Murali, R. Vinayagamoorthy, B. Nirmal Kumar, G. S. N. Rao and Mervin A. Herbert and has published in prestigious journals such as SHILAP Revista de lepidopterología, Journal of Cleaner Production and International Journal of Hydrogen Energy.
